How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Jeffries Point Airport?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Jeffries Point Airport Studio Apartments | $3,372 | $1,550 | $10,000+ |
Jeffries Point Airport 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,428 | $1,175 | $10,000+ |
Jeffries Point Airport 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,944 | $2,000 | $10,000+ |
Jeffries Point Airport 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,482 | $1,275 | $10,000+ |
Jeffries Point Airport 4 Bedroom Apartments | $5,190 | $1,075 | $10,000+ |
Jeffries Point Airport 5 Bedroom Apartments | $3,996 | $1,125 | $7,995 |

Getting Around the Jeffries Point Airport Neighborhood in East Boston, MA
Walk Score®
88 / 100
Very Walkable
Most errands can be accomplished on foot
Bike Score®
71 / 100
Very Bikeable
Biking is convenient for most trips
Transit Score®
82 / 100
Excellent Transit
Transit is convenient for most trips
